Effective Communication with Multidisciplinary Healthcare Teams
Context and Background:
In the dynamic landscape of pharmaceutical sales, effective communication with multidisciplinary healthcare teams is paramount.
These teams often consist of doctors, nurses, pharmacists, and administrators, each with their own priorities, perspectives, and communication preferences. Sales representatives must navigate these diverse roles and personalities to convey the value proposition of their products effectively and foster collaboration among team members. This case study delves into strategies for adapting communication styles to engage with each stakeholder group and promote effective collaboration in healthcare settings.

But amidst the flurry of activity and diverse perspectives, challenges emerge. Each stakeholder group brings its priorities, preferences, and communication styles to the table. The doctors seek evidence-based data and clinical efficacy, the nurses value patient-centric approaches and ease of administration, the pharmacists prioritize safety and compatibility, while the administrators emphasize cost-effectiveness and operational efficiency.
Navigating this intricate landscape requires finesse, empathy, and adaptability. Your representative must tailor their communication approach to address the unique needs and preferences of each stakeholder group, leveraging their interpersonal skills to build rapport, convey credibility, and inspire confidence in the value of your product.
